Laura Esguerra

Laura lost her battle with cancer on Saturday night. Her sister Celia blogs about her loss with love and a heavy heart at 5th and Spring. I never met Laura and I believe only met Celia once on a story assignment several years ago, but their updates on the disease (including at Laura's own website) touched the L.A. blogging community. Many responded to a blood drive earlier this month, and some will remember the photo of Laura's downtown rooftop wedding in May. Celia has posted information about services here and in Hawaii. Laura was 36 years old. (Update: James Adams announces his wife's passing and expresses relief that she is no longer in pain. 10:05 p.m.)
